CARY, N.C., May 19 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Cornerstone Therapeutics Inc. (Nasdaq CM: CRTX), formerly known as Critical Therapeutics, Inc., a specialty pharmaceutical company focused on acquiring, developing and commercializing significant products primarily for the respiratory market, today announced the departure of Scott B. Townsend, Esq., General Counsel and Executive Vice President of Legal Affairs, effective June 5, 2009. The Company has already begun a search for a successor. "I would like to thank Scott for his contributions to the Company during his many years of service, and in particular since the closing of last year's merger," said Craig A. Collard, Cornerstone's President and Chief Executive Officer. "Scott's knowledge of Critical Therapeutics' pre-merger business was especially helpful as we integrated the operations of the combined company and filed our first post-merger Annual Report on Form 10-K and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q, as well as the Proxy Statement for our first post-merger annual stockholders' meeting, which will be held on May 28, 2009. Scott recognized that, at this juncture in our development, we need a general counsel who is located full-time at our North Carolina headquarters, but told us that, for family reasons, he is currently unable to relocate from Massachusetts. Thus, we mutually agreed that it would be prudent to make this management change at this time. We appreciate Scott agreeing to remain with us through our annual stockholders' meeting." Cornerstone currently retains Raleigh, North Carolina-based Smith, Anderson, Blount, Dorsett, Mitchell & Jernigan, L.L.P. as its external legal counsel.
